The recorded mileage of 80,497 miles is low for a 29 year old vehicle, averaging roughly 2,776 miles per year. The odometer remained static at 80,497 miles between the failure on 9 July 2025 and the pass on 18 July 2025. This low usage often indicates a car that has spent long periods standing, which can lead to perished rubber components, seized calipers, or fuel system degradation. A buyer must scrutinize the braking system and exhaust during a physical inspection. The 9 July 2025 failure noted that brake performance and emissions were unable to be tested, which often points to deeper mechanical issues or a lack of preparation before the test. Although the car passed shortly after, the nature of these failures suggests the vehicle may have been neglected prior to the most recent certification. Attention should also be paid to the structural integrity of the seat belt anchorages and the condition of the webbing. The tester flagged a significant reduction in the strength of the central seat belt anchorage on 9 July 2025. Given the age of the Fiat 126, a thorough check for chassis corrosion around these mounting points is essential to ensure the repairs were structural and not merely cosmetic.
